May 2025 - Apr 2026Orion Way area has the 4th highest crime rate of 24 local areas in Northall , and the 99th highest crime rate of 1,075 local areas in North Northamptonshire .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Orion Way (NN15 6NL) in the last 12 months was 191.4 per 1,000 residents and was 19.4% higher than the Northall average (160.3 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Shoplifting with 18 offences recorded. The least common crime was Robbery with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Vehicle crime ( 300.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Burglary ( -60.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 12 (≈ 32.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 33.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-86.4%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Orion Way (NN15 6NL), the main crime hotspot is near Highfield Crescent. Police recorded 20 crimes here, including 11 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
